在数字资产日益走向日常的今天,安全不再是附加项,而是产品的灵魂。针对TP钱包的风险与防护,以下以分步指南的形式系统阐述,帮助开发者、产品经理与用户构建坚固防线。
步骤一:明确威胁模型
1.1 划分攻击面:设备端(操作系统、应用沙箱)、网络(钓鱼、MITM)、应用层(权限滥用、逻辑缺陷)、合约层(参数误配置、权限中心化)。
1.2 识别资产:助记词/私钥、交易签名权限、用户元数据。
步骤二:多功能钱包的安全设计
2.1 最少权限原则:模块化权限管理、将签名权限隔离为独立组件。
2.2 强化密钥管理:推荐硬件/安全芯片、分层备份与冷热钱包策略。
步骤三:高效数据处理与隐私保护
3.1 数据最小化:仅收集必要的使用数据并加密存储。

3.2 安全传输与本地加密:使用端到端加密和内存清理,避免敏感数据久驻。
步骤四:高效支付应用的可信交互
4.1 明确签名意图:在UI中以可理解语言展示交易要点,防止误操作。
4.2 反钓鱼与反篡改:域名校验、白名单与风险提示机制。
5.1 参数透明化:将关键参数(如管理员、多签阈值、可升级性)写入文档并在链上可查。
5.2 审计与回滚:采用第三方审计、引入时限锁和可验证的升级流程,减少单点失效风险。
步骤六:高效能创新模式与发展策略
6.1 模块化与SDK:把钱包能力抽象为可验证的模块,便于迭代与第三方审查。
6.2 激励开源与漏洞赏金:社区驱动能显著提升发现与修复效率。
步骤七:监测、响应与用户教育
7.1 实时异常检测:行为分析、交易速率与黑白名单触发告警。
7.2 事件响应流程:隔离、通知、快速修补与补偿机制。
7.3 用户教育:定期推送最佳实践与反诈骗指南。

结语:安全是系统工程,不是一次性任务。通过分层防御、透明治理与持续迭代,TP钱包可以在多功能性与易用性之间建立信任的桥梁,让用户在探索数字金融时更安心自如。
评论
Alex
写得很系统,合约参数那段尤其实用,受益匪浅。
小梅
关于密钥管理能否再多讲讲硬件钱包与备份策略?很想深入了解。
CryptoFan
喜欢最后的‘安全是系统工程’这句话,确实需要长期投入。
张扬
建议增加实际演练(演习)流程,验证应急响应是否有效。
Luna
文章语言优美,条理清晰,适合产品团队内训分享。